Children Residential Team Leader

3 months ago


Warwickshire, United Kingdom The Cambian Group Full time

Are you committed achieving positive outcomes for others?

Are you flexible enough to achieve the above?

Do you have a full UK driving licence and your own car?

If you can answer a wholehearted YES to the three questions above we would love to hear from you immediately

Position: Support Worker & Senior Support Worker (Children’s Residential)

Location: Warwickshire Complex Care

Hourly Rate: £13.40 > £14.22 (dependant on experience/qualifications)

OT Rate: 1.25

Gross annual pay based on full time hours + 10 Sleep ins: £30, > £32, (dependant on experience/qualifications)

How would you feel knowing that the things you do daily are making a real difference to the lives of others?

At Cambian Complex, our vision is to inspire lives and to continually develop them. And not just the individuals in our care but their families and communities too As a leading provider, we are making sure that the support we offer is constant, reliable and of the highest possible quality at all times.

We are currently welcoming applications from enthusiastic candidates to join our team.

In this role you will join an experienced and supportive team within a beautiful and fully equipped setting. You will share the same unified goal to actively enable each and every one of the children and young people in our care to achieve their own personal best

We are immensely proud of every single one of our responsible and committed individuals and their constant pursuit towards achieving the highest possible standards and outcomes for the children and young people in our care and also each other.

Our first commitment to anybody starting a career at Cambian is to offer best in class inductions, best in class training, and continuous support and development via our best in class and completely dedicated Learning & Development Team.

All that we require of new applicants is that you have the experience to be able to demonstrate our shared values - You must demonstrate positivity and innovation, be friendly, empowering, person-centred and perhaps most importantly, be enthusiastic in your actions.

These values are more important than where we have worked or the positions we have held. They underpin the decisions we make and the actions we take to achieve the best possible outcomes for all involved. If you can easily demonstrate the above, we can give you all the support you require to become a best in class Support Worker, a best in class Team Leader or a best in class Deputy Manager and beyond.

Cambian are committed to promoting the safeguarding and welfare of all children within our care. All applicants must be willing to undergo and enhanced DBS check and must be able to provide at least two references covering the past two years. Applicants must also provide information for all positions related to working with children and the vulnerable and details of employment going back to full time education.
